From 578826cd613bc6fb3a18e38d0758f05a8b0d0f3b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ron Buckton Date: Wed, 10 May 2017 16:41:30 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] Adds definitions for the es2017 Atomics global object --- src/lib/es2017.sharedmemory.d.ts | 93 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++- src/lib/es5.d.ts | 48 ++++++++++------- 2 files changed, 120 insertions(+), 21 deletions(-) diff --git a/src/lib/es2017.sharedmemory.d.ts b/src/lib/es2017.sharedmemory.d.ts index e18390a5591..b9a9b0f7e10 100644 --- a/src/lib/es2017.sharedmemory.d.ts +++ b/src/lib/es2017.sharedmemory.d.ts @@ -23,5 +23,96 @@ interface SharedArrayBufferConstructor { readonly prototype: SharedArrayBuffer; new (byteLength: number): SharedArrayBuffer; } +declare var SharedArrayBuffer: SharedArrayBufferConstructor; -declare var SharedArrayBuffer: SharedArrayBufferConstructor; \ No newline at end of file +interface ArrayBufferTypes { + SharedArrayBuffer: SharedArrayBuffer; +} + +interface Atomics { + /** + * Adds a value to the value at the given position in the array, returning the original value. + * Until this atomic operation completes, any other read or write operation against the array + * will block. + */ + add(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, value: number): number; + + /** + * Stores the bitwise AND of a value with the value at the given position in the array, + * returning the original value. Until this atomic operation completes, any other read or + * write operation against the array will block. + */ + and(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, value: number): number; + + /** + * Replaces the value at the given position in the array if the original value equals the given + * expected value, returning the original value. Until this atomic operation completes, any + * other read or write operation against the array will block. + */ + compareExchange(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, expectedValue: number, replacementValue: number): number; + + /** + * Replaces the value at the given position in the array, returning the original value. Until + * this atomic operation completes, any other read or write operation against the array will + * block. + */ + exchange(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, value: number): number; + + /** + * Returns a value indicating whether high-performance algorithms can use atomic operations + * (`true`) or must use locks (`false`) for the given number of bytes-per-element of a typed + * array. + */ + isLockFree(size: number): boolean; + + /** + * Returns the value at the given position in the array. Until this atomic operation completes, + * any other read or write operation against the array will block. + */ + load(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number): number; + + /** + * Stores the bitwise OR of a value with the value at the given position in the array, + * returning the original value. Until this atomic operation completes, any other read or write + * operation against the array will block. + */ + or(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, value: number): number; + + /** + * Stores a value at the given position in the array, returning the new value. Until this + * atomic operation completes, any other read or write operation against the array will block. + */ + store(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, value: number): number; + + /** + * Subtracts a value from the value at the given position in the array, returning the original + * value. Until this atomic operation completes, any other read or write operation against the + * array will block. + */ + sub(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, value: number): number; + + /** + * If the value at the given position in the array is equal to the provided value, the current + * agent is put to sleep causing execution to suspend until the timeout expires (returning + * `"timed-out"`) or until the agent is awoken (returning `"ok"`); otherwise, returns + * `"not-equal"`. + */ + wait(typedArray: Int32Array, index: number, value: number, timeout?: number): "ok" | "not-equal" | "timed-out"; + + /** + * Wakes up sleeping agents that are waiting on the given index of the array, returning the + * number of agents that were awoken. + */ + wake(typedArray: Int32Array, index: number, count: number): number; + + /** + * Stores the bitwise XOR of a value with the value at the given position in the array, + * returning the original value. Until this atomic operation completes, any other read or write + * operation against the array will block. + */ + xor(typedArray: Int8Array | Uint8Array | Int16Array | Uint16Array | Int32Array | Uint32Array, index: number, value: number): number; + + readonly [Symbol.toStringTag]: "Atomics"; +} + +declare var Atomics: Atomics; \ No newline at end of file diff --git a/src/lib/es5.d.ts b/src/lib/es5.d.ts index 23805495b69..3a85f4ddad9 100644 --- a/src/lib/es5.d.ts +++ b/src/lib/es5.d.ts @@ -1386,6 +1386,14 @@ interface ArrayBuffer { slice(begin: number, end?: number): ArrayBuffer;
